Olympic champion Valerie Adams has continued her fine run with victory in the women's shot put at the latest Diamond League event in Lausanne, Switzerland.
Adams won the event with a throw of 20.95 metres, 25 centimetres further than her gold medal throw at the London Olympics but still short of her second best recorded before the Games.
It is the New Zealander's second Diamond League victory in two weeks, and third of the season, after winning in Stockholm last weekend.
Her best effort was more 1.35 metres further than second placed Michelle Carter of the USA.
Olympics silver medalist Yevgeniya Kolodko finished in third more than two metres behind Adams.
